How to Optimize Your Movement in CS2: Tips and Tricks
Optimizing your movement in CS2 is crucial for enhancing your gameplay experience and achieving better outcomes in matches. First, mastering the fundamentals is key. Focus on your WASD keys, ensuring you practice strafing, crouch jumping, and counter-strafing. To effectively improve, consider implementing the following tips:
- Practice Bunny Hopping: This technique allows you to maintain momentum while changing direction.
- Utilize Shift for Silent Movement: Use the shift key to move silently, allowing for stealthy approaches.
- Learn to Strafe Around Corners: This can help you dodge enemy fire while keeping your crosshair on target.
Additionally, understanding the maps and utilizing the environment can greatly enhance your movement. Familiarity with each map's terrain will allow you to navigate effectively and take advantage of cover. When trying to optimize your movement in CS2, remember to:
- Use Sound Cues: Pay attention to footsteps and other audio cues that can guide your movement decisions.
- Experiment with Settings: Adjust your mouse sensitivity and key bindings to find what feels most comfortable for your gameplay.
- Watch Professional Players: Observing how top-tier players maneuver can provide valuable insights into effective movement strategies.
